Title: |
Talent Acquisition and Management |
Career: |
Graduate |
Credit Hours: |
3.00 |
Description: |
Theories and techniques of key human resource management functions of HR planning and selection. A systems approach is used to explore HR planning as the managing of supply and demand for labor internal and external to the organization. Multiple strategies are examined for measuring predicted job performance to effectively plan, recruit, and select employees. |
